[Krimel]
In this particular instance dmb was falling victim to the illusion that
because we remember, have records and live with the consequences of a
particular flow of events that that particular flow is fixed and certain. He appears at least to be supporting the kind of view that Ham espouses when he claims that the universe from some godlike perceptive is a fait accompli. I
am saying that first of all time is not reversible but if it were it would
not rewind like a movie. To get to the past you would have to pass through
the same sort of indeterminacies that we pass through moving forward in time
and that as a result we could not return to any point in time that we have
been in previously. Not only that I am saying that our knowledge of the past is insufficient to make certain judgments about why things happened the way
they did. History is the mixture of educated guesses. The farther back in
time we try to look the harder it is to make accurate guesses as to what
shaped events of the past.

I mentioned the Kennedy assassination but recently I asserted that one of
the chief motivations of Plato and other early Greek thinkers was to
incorporate the stunning achievements of the Greek mathematicians into the
lives of ordinary Athenians. Matt then advanced the notion that Plato was
driven by bitterness and personal grief over the treatment of his mentor at
the hands of Athenian authorities. Who can say which is which? Does either
theory account for the facts or just express our respective personal
prejudice?
